Figure 4.11 Molecular structures of typical crown-ether complexes with alkali metal cations (a) sodium-water-benzo-I5-crown-5 showing pentagonal-pyramidal coordination of Na by 6 oxygen atoms (b) 18-crown-6-potassium-ethyl acetoacetate enolate showing unsymmelrical coordination of K by 8 oxygen atoms and (c) the RbNCS ion pair coordinated by dibenzo-I8-crown-6 to give seven-fold coordination about Rb. Methyl pyruvate thiosemicarbazone in the presence of zinc chloride or acetate resulted in the formation of complexes with the ligand hydrolyzed or transesterified. The complexes with pyruvate thiosemicarbazone, ZnL2, or ethyl pyruvate thiosemicarbazone, ZnLCl2 were structurally characterized by single-crystal X-ray crystallography showing respectively a distorted octahedral and distorted square pyramidal geometry.874... [Pg.1225]

The amino acid complexes [TcNCl(L)(PPh3)] (HL=L-cysteine, L-cysteine ethyl ester, cysteamine) have been prepared from [TcNC PPlfj ] or ASPI14 [TcNCU]/PPh3 [88]. The crystal structure of the L-cysteine ethyl ester complex 21 shows a Tc=N bond length of 1.605(3) A and the Tc atom displaced by 0.594(1) A above the square basal plane [88]. Other structurally characterized examples are the square pyramidal 22 with ONSP coordination and Tc=N 1.611(3) A [81], and 23 with NSPC1 coordination and Tc=N 1.615(7) A [89],... [Pg.54]

Sulfoxides possess a non-planar pyramidal configuration consequently, chiral sulfoxides can exist as optical enantiomers (see Chapter 5, p. 63). This is illustrated by the structures (33a) and (33b) showing the optical isomers of ethyl methyl sulfoxide (Figure 2). [Pg.41]

Structural models for the co-ordination geometries of a Cu-Cu" redox couple in copper enzymes suggest a mechanism for where both electrons and protons are involved a model has been characterized bis(imidazole) copper(ii) diacetate (102). Dark green crystals of [Cu(caffeine)Cl2,H20] in which copper is tetragonal pyramidal distorted towards trigonal bipyramidal have been characterized Cu—Ni = 1.98 A,Cu—0(H20) = 1.96 A, Cu—Cl = 2.32,2.25 A.
